The ETF (Exchange Traded Fund) market has recently seen the launch of several new products. One such ETF is the Invesco Solar ETF (TAN), which tracks the performance of the global solar energy industry.
This ETF is designed to provide investors with exposure to the solar energy sector, which has seen tremendous growth in recent years.

The ETF holds a portfolio of stocks in solar-focused companies, such as SunPower Corporation, Enphase Energy, Canadian Solar Inc., and First Solar. These companies are some of the leading players in the solar energy industry and have shown strong performance in the past.

In terms of the ETF issuer, Invesco is a leading global asset manager with over $1 trillion of assets under management. The firm is known for its expertise in managing ETFs and other investments, and is well-respected in the industry.
